The Data Mine, iconThe sheer number of personal technology devices has led to an explosion in the amount of raw data produced in society. Twenty billion devices are now connected to the internet; it is estimated that by 2030, that number will rise to 1 trillion. All of these devices are constantly producing data.

Data scientists are the critical link that transform this data into information that can be applied to solve real-word problems. The study of this data affects every citizen and is needed in every sector. Data science solutions are applied to everything from preventive maintenance in manufacturing to food science initiatives that address food insecurity.   

The Data Mine is a living, learning and research-based community created to introduce students to data science concepts and equip them to create solutions to real-world problems. Members of The Data Mine will be part of a team, living, studying and ultimately, performing data-driven research together. The Data Mine is part of Purdue University’s Integrative Data Science Initiative, which is designed to train students across all majors with the data literacy needed to succeed in a data-driven world.

The Data Mine experience allows students the opportunity to live and learn in a community that revolves around a particular topic or theme. The topics and themes studied within The Data Mine incorporate components relevant to any field of study. 

The Data Mine is open to students from any major of study. Students will learn some of the skills most sought after by companies and graduate programs. No computational background is required. The key trait for joining The Data Mine is the desire to learn data science in a rigorous, but welcoming environment.

The Data Mine - Corporate Partnerships

Students describe their experience in The Data Mine like having an internship during the academic year - it is experiential learning at its best using project-based work and industry mentorship along the way. Students work with real-world data and real-world challenges ultimately helping them build data literacy skills they need to be successful in their future careers.  Learn more about the student experience (video)
